## Your Love: A Classic of 80s Pop Rock

“Your Love” is an iconic track by the English rock band The Outfield, a song that has solidified its place in the annals of 80s pop rock. Originally featured on their 1985 debut album, *Play Deep*, it was released as a single in early 1986 and rapidly ascended the charts, becoming a global sensation.

Penned by guitarist John Spinks during an impromptu writing session with vocalist Tony Lewis, the song’s creation is almost as legendary as the track itself. Born from a casual gathering at Spinks’ flat, “Your Love” was crafted in a mere twenty minutes, a testament to the raw talent and chemistry of the band members. Interestingly, the lyrics, though evocative and relatable, are entirely fictional, a product of the duo’s creative imagination.

Musically, the song is a vibrant fusion of new wave, power pop, and pop rock. The driving rhythm, combined with Tony Lewis’s soaring vocals, creates an infectious energy that has captivated audiences for decades. While the lyrics paint a somewhat ambiguous picture of a romantic encounter, the song’s universal appeal lies in its ability to evoke a range of emotions and interpretations.

“Your Love” was a commercial juggernaut, reaching number six on the Billboard Hot 100 and number seven on the Album Rock Tracks chart. Its enduring popularity is a testament to its timeless quality and the band’s ability to craft a perfect pop song. Decades later, “Your Love” continues to resonate with listeners, serving as a nostalgic reminder of a golden era in music.
